Ceramic balls

The main characteristics of ceramic balls are high temperature and resistance to corrosion, together with excellent mechanical resistance. They do not require lubrication.
Ceramic balls

SILICON NITRIDE

(SI3N4)
It is the most used ceramic material because has a high resistance to corrosion, working efficiently until a temperature up to +1200ºC. It presents extreme hardness and can be manufactured in high precision. It has a weight 60% lower than steel. This material does not require lubrication. It is used mainly in the aerospace industry.

ALUMINA OXIDE

(AL2O3)
It presents a bigger resistance to temperature that the silicon nitride, as well as a high resistance to corrosion, resisting most of the corrosive agents except hydrofluoric and hydrochloric acid.

ZIRCONIA OXIDE

(ZRO2)
Material with a very low electric conductivity, presents high flexibility. Small sizes (between 0,2 - 3,3 mm) are used for pigments production due to its high resistance to wear.

Frequently asked questions

What are the main characteristics of ceramic balls?

They are balls with high hardness and wear resistance. Their operating temperature is very high, reaching up to 1600 °C in the case of alumina oxide balls. One of their main characteristics is their corrosion resistance, even when in contact with strong acids, as is the case with silicon nitride balls.

What are the applications of precision ceramic balls?

Special bearings, pumps and valves in corrosive environments, measuring instruments, and flow meters. They are used in the aerospace, oil, chemical, and electronics industries.
